Configuring Your Server 4-35
7. Press F10 to create virtual drive.
The "Virtual Drives Configured" screen appears. (The figure below shows an example of
RAID1 configured with two hard disk drives.)
8. Select "RAID," "Size", "DWC", "RA", or "Span" by using cursor keys. Then press Enter
to fix the selection and set each value.
(1) "RAID": Sets RAID level.
Parameter Remarks
0 RAID0
1 RAID1
10 Striping of RAID1
The selectable RAID level varies depending on the number of hard disk drives
that configure a pack.
(2) "Size": Sets virtual drive size.
Up to 8 virtual drives can be created per RAID Controller.
(3) "DWC": Sets parameter for Disk Write Cache.
Parameter Remarks
Off Write through
On *
1
Write back
*1 Recommended setting.
"Write-back On" enables good performance, however, cache data may be lost
at an unexpected power failure. "Write-back Off" reduces performance by
approximately 50%.
(4) "RA": Sets parameter for Read Ahead.
Parameter Remarks
Off Does not perform read ahead.
On Performs read ahead.
